Transaction e8beca4c9c65d0883c030f503bb3f2b4e23ab1179d3cce09f787747bfb69e7a0
1 Input
1 Output
-
e8beca4c9c65d0883c030f503bb3f2b4e23ab1179d3cce09f787747bfb69e7a0:0
- value
- 1582408
- script pubkey
- OP_0 OP_PUSHBYTES_20 666bf3f95d54d4d5da388612f55b7caef63cf93a
- address
- bc1qve4l872a2n2dtk3cscf02kmu4mmre7f6f9j30q